Consider what environment your little one thrives in. Do they blossom with lots of structured activity, or do they need a quieter, more exploratory pace? Many top-rated daycares in our area embrace play-based learning, understanding that through guided play, children develop cognitive, social, and motor skills naturally. Others might incorporate specific educational philosophies like Montessori or Reggio Emilia, which emphasize child-led discovery and hands-on learning.
As you begin to explore local options, your most powerful tool is the in-person visit. Schedule a tour and trust your instincts. Pay attention to the feeling you get when you walk in. Is the atmosphere warm and joyful? Observe the interactions between the caregivers and the children. In the best settings, you’ll see teachers engaged at eye level, speaking kindly, and genuinely listening. Notice if the children seem content and busy. Don’t hesitate to ask detailed questions about daily routines, teacher qualifications and tenure, safety protocols, and how they handle everything from diaper changes to those inevitable toddler conflicts. A top daycare will welcome your questions with transparency and pride.
